Abstract

The present invention relates to a kind of personal environmental temperature adjusting device (1), it has an air-flow and produces equipment (2), and a temperature effect equipment and an airflow guiding device (4) guide air by described temperature effect equipment by described airflow guiding device.In order to reach the purpose of utilizing temperature to adjust required energy as far as possible, described temperature effect equipment is as the part of a Stirling cooling device (8).

Background technology
As everyone knows, the comfortable environment weather has the effect of improvement to people's comfort.Therefore, all be equiped with air-conditioning system in a lot of buildings.By air-conditioning system, just can adjust the temperature in the building, make the interior temperature of described building be higher than or be lower than the temperature of building external.
Yet the air-conditioning system in this building has a weak point, and that is exactly to have very high energy consumption.Additionally, the temperature in the building can only be configured to unified temperature value usually.In fact, also be possible for independent room provides temperature control, but this often means that higher cost.Similarly, only may give whole room design temperature.For example, for an office, several people are arranged simultaneously in interior office, probably some people thinks that temperature sets too lowly, and other people has thought that temperature set De Taigao.
US 6481213B2 proposes a kind of thermal comfort system, and this thermal comfort system only influences the temperature of single personnel's surrounding environment.In this thermal comfort system, air is sucked into and guides by a temperature effect equipment.In a better embodiment, described temperature effect equipment is thermoelectric heatpump (thermo-electrical heat pump), i.e. Peltier element (Peltier-element).
US 5499504 illustrates a kind of similar system by Peltier element work.
US 7426835B2 illustrates a kind of further system, and described system produces cold air by a thermoelectric element.
A benefit of Peltier element is that in work, it only requires the supply direct current.Further, in work, in fact it can not produce noise.This benefit is not conclusive, because most noise is caused by air-flow.But on the angle of energy, Peltier element is not good selection comparatively speaking.Considerable energy demand is used to provide cooling output.
Summary of the invention
The present invention is based on that the task of being used for thermoregulator energy how well proposes.
By personal environmental temperature adjusting device, this task can be resolved, and wherein, described temperature effect device is as the part of Stirling cooling device (Stirling cooling device).
The Stirling cooling device is the machine according to the work of Stirling principle, and it comprises a pressure wave generator and a buanch unit.Described pressure wave generator is generally a piston cylinder unit.Described buanch unit comprises that one is arranged on a promotion gas in a heated side and the reciprocating cylinder body of a cold side.Normally, described buanch unit and described pressure wave generator work shift scope relative to each other are between 45 ° to 90 °.Described buanch unit is as the heat conductor that heat is sent to described heated side from described cold side.Therefore, for certain cooling output is provided, only require less relatively energy.
Preferably, described Stirling cooling device comprises that one has a cold side as radiator, and air can be allowed to by described radiator.Cool off described air if desired, only need simply with the cold side and the described heat exchanger of described air guiding by described buanch unit.The heat that comprises in the described air is also partly absorbed by described radiator and is sent to described heated side by described Stirling cooling device, and in described heated side, described heat can be distributed in the environment.The required energy of described Stirling cooling device running has heated environment extraly.But, be directed to except the place by described temperature effect equipment heating or cooling if remove the discharge air of heat from the heated side of described buanch unit, in fact the temperature increase of the described discharge air that is caused by the energy of described Stirling cooling device consumption can be left in the basket.
Preferably, provide a thermal source, air can be conducted through described thermal source.Therefore described temperature adjustment device not only can be used for cooling off the surrounding environment of individual or object, can also be used to increasing by a small margin the temperature of described environment.About described environment temperature, the maximum temperature variation is effective at 5 to 10 ℃ usually.
Advantageously, described thermal source is an electric resistance.Cool off described air if desired, then start described Stirling cooling device.Heat described air if desired, then close described Stirling cooling device, and start described electric resistance.In this case, do not need air-flow guiding is made a change.
Alternatively, perhaps additionally, described thermal source can be formed by the heated side of the buanch unit of described Stirling cooling device.As previously mentioned, the buanch unit of described Stirling cooling device is as heat conductor.The heat that conducts to described heated side can be used for heating described air supplied, therefore has good energy utilization efficiency.
Preferably, described airflow guiding device comprises a switching device, by described switching device, can optionally described thermal source or described radiator be passed through in described air guiding.By described switching device, described temperature regulating equipment can be selected to heating or cooling.Described switching device can have simple design, in fact, is enough to meet the demands once a rotary tablet or a valve that can change.
Preferably, described temperature adjustment device is a mobile unit, desktop installation unit, body of wall installation unit, perhaps roof installation unit.The desktop installation unit can be fixed on the working face, on desk, thereby provides cold air or hot-air for the individual who works altogether at described desk place.Similarly, this also is applicable to work chair or other workplaces.Body of wall is installed or the roof installation unit can be suspended on respectively on body of wall or the roof.Because the Stirling cooling device is as temperature effect equipment, the direction in space that described temperature adjustment device is installed can be unrestricted.Therefore described temperature regulating equipment can be installed in the surface of inclination or be fixed on the side, utilizes the cooling device of oil lubricating compressor work then can not so install.
Preferably, described mobile unit, the desktop installation unit, the body of wall installation unit, perhaps the roof installation unit has the head that a tubular bracket by formation part airflow guiding device is connected to a foot.Thereby can separate the air that is conducted through described support simply and have the discharge air that has different temperatures with described air.This is a kind of simple method of improving users'comfort.
Preferably, described Stirling equipment is installed in described foot.This has two benefits, at first, described Stirling equipment is installed in described foot makes described foot have enough weight, and the stability that this has increased device also makes described support have certain length; Secondly, the outward appearance of described device can be designed to vision close friend's form, and described foot can have certain volume but still have friendly visual appearance.
Preferably, described support is deformable.Therefore, thereby described head can be positioned and guides described air-conditioning gas, and promptly described cold wind or hot blast are to the place that the user needs.

The specific embodiment
Fig. 1 is the schematic diagram of personal environmental temperature adjusting device.Described personal environmental temperature adjusting device 1 has air-flow and produces equipment 2.In the present embodiment, described air-flow generation equipment 2 is fans.Except fan, other equipment that can produce gas flow also can be applied to the present invention.For example, can provide air by the mode of gravity.
As shown in arrow 3, described air-flow generation equipment provides air, to object 5 places, adjusts air by temperature by airflow guiding device 4 guiding air 3, is also referred to as air-conditioning gas 6 hereinafter, and described object 5 is worked.
In order to regulate air themperature, just, provide temperature to be different from air in the temperature of the porch of airflow guiding device 4, described temperature-adjusting device has comprised the Stirling cooling device 8 that only simply illustrates at this.Described Stirling cooling device 8 comprises a pressure wave (pressure wave) generator 9.Described pressure wave generator 9 is connected to a buanch unit 10.Described buanch unit 10 comprises a piston.Described piston is not shown specifically in the drawings, and its pressure wave that is produced with respect to described pressure wave generator 9 is 45 ° to 90 ° of travel(l)ing phases typically.In simple example, described pressure wave generator 9 has one equally by moving back and forth the piston that produces corresponding pressure wave.The public that is designed to of Si Teli cooling device knows, only for understanding when of the present invention it made an explanation hereinafter.
Described buanch unit 10 is as heat transfer device, and it comprises a cold side and the heated side as thermal source 12 as radiator 11.In order to cool off air 3, described air is directed to described radiator 11 places.Described radiator 11 is connected to a heat exchanger 13.Described heat exchanger 13 holds from the heat of air 3 and is transferred to described radiator 11.For for purpose of brevity, at this air to be cooled 3 is shown simply and is conducted through described radiator.Under certain situation, also can advantageously as mentioned, use a heat exchanger 13 to obtain the effect that better heat is transferred to described radiator 11 from described air 3.If because the reason that necessarily requires of design can be used heat quantity transfer device between air and radiator 11, as be filled with " heat pipe ", the thermal siphon of evaporative fluid or other cause heat quantity transfer device by conduction or convection type.
Described buanch unit 10 is transferred to described thermal source 12 with heat from described radiator 11.From described thermal source 12, heat dissipates to environment.But because air-conditioning gas 6 is sent out and is directed to object 5 (perhaps individual) a different position, described object 5 (perhaps individual) is not subjected to the effect at the air of thermal source 12 places discharge.
Similarly, described thermal source 12 can be connected to other places by the heat conduction pattern, and air to be heated is conducted through described other places.For simplicity's sake, hereinafter referred to as " the guiding air passes through thermal source ".
The Stirling cooling device has efficient relatively preferably.In order to produce the cooling capacity of 50W, described Stirling cooling device needs the inlet power of 25W.If produce the cooling capacity of 50W, then need the inlet power of 100W by Peltier element.Stirling cooling device 8 can installed on the direction in space arbitrarily, and under the situation of the refrigeration circuit that utilizes traditional oil lubricating compressor, then the direction of An Zhuaning has special requirement.
Fig. 2 is temperature adjustment device 1 design among Fig. 1 and the schematic diagram of operator scheme.Components identical has identical label.Arrow is represented different air-flows.
Advantageously, described radiator 11 and described thermal source 12 are arranged on the both sides of a divider wall 14.It is easier with separating of discharge air 15 that this can make to air-conditioning gas 6.
Described air-flow produces equipment 2 to the both sides of described divider wall 14 supply intake air 16, so part of air, and this part can become described air-conditioning gas 6 subsequently, is conducted through radiator 11.Another part 17 of air can be used to cool off described pressure wave generator 9.Heated like this air is discharged as discharged air 15 by discharge-channel 18 or corresponding air exhaust openings.Described air-conditioning gas 6 can easily be seen in Fig. 6, is supplied by a head 19.
Fig. 3 shows an embodiment of revising a little, and the part identical with Fig. 2 has identical label among the figure.In Fig. 3, additionally show a firing equipment 20, as a heating equipment.For example, an Ohmic resistance can pass to electric current and produce certain heat output.When described firing equipment 20 startups, clearly, it will separate with described Stirling cooling device 8.In this case, described intake air 16 is conducted through described radiator 11.But, when described radiator 11 is not activated, described intake air 16 will keep its temperature until it by 20 heating of described firing equipment and be used as air-conditioning gas 6 and be supplied by described head 19.
Described temperature adjustment device 1 also can only be used for heating described air-conditioning gas 6.Such embodiment is shown in Figure 4.Components identical has identical label in the drawings.In this case, the described air 21 that is conducted through described radiator 11 is used as and discharges air 15 and be discharged from by described gas discharge channel 18.But, describedly be conducted through described thermal source 12, and if requirement, also the part air 17 by described pressure wave generator 9 is supplied by described head 19 as air-conditioning gas 6.This also is a kind of operating position of the energy preferably, because therefore described buanch unit 10 has the output that requires bigger form of heat than its operation as heat conductor work meeting.
At last, Fig. 5 shows one preferred embodiment.Has identical label with Fig. 1 to Fig. 4 components identical among the figure.In the described temperature adjustment device shown in Figure 5, described air-conditioning gas 6 can described intake air 16 be cooled or situation about heating under optionally produced.In order to realize this point, part air 17 is conducted through described thermal source 12, and if requirement, also by described pressure wave generator 9.The part 21 of intake air 16 is conducted through described radiator 11.Two parts 17 of described air, 21 reach a switching device 22, described switching device 22 or with described be conducted through the cooled air of described radiator 11 guide to described head 19, perhaps the described heated air that is conducted through described thermal source 12 is guided to described air discharge channel 18, or vice versa, be about to the described air that is conducted through described radiator 11 and guide to air discharge channel 18, perhaps the described air that is conducted through described thermal source is guided to described head 19.
Fig. 7 shows described switching device 22.The original paper identical with Fig. 1 to Fig. 4 has identical label among the figure.
For brevity, there is shown air-flow 17,21.It should be noted that described air-flow 17 comprises that by the air of described thermal source 12 heating, described air-flow 21 comprises by the air of described radiator 11 coolings.
In the situation shown in Fig. 7 a, one can be mounted the location by the plate 23 that the mode that is not shown specifically is adjusted from the outside, make described heated air 17 be supplied, and described cooled air 21 is discharged as discharging air 15 as air-conditioning gas 6.In the situation shown in figure Fig. 7 b, described plate 23 is moved and makes described cooled air 21 be supplied as air-conditioning gas 6, and described heated air 17 is discharged as discharging air 15.
As shown in Figure 6, preferably, described personal environmental temperature adjusting device 1 is as a kind of table-top unit, and described table-top unit comprises foot 24 and the tubular bracket 25 that described foot 24 is connected to described head 19.Described support 25 comprises deformable segment 26 as tubular articles, makes an outlet opening 24 that is arranged on described head optionally to align with specific objective.Described floss hole 18 is arranged on the side of described foot 24.Executive component 18 is arranged on the place ahead of described foot 24.Similarly, described personal environmental temperature adjusting device 1 can be used as also that body of wall is installed or the roof installation unit, perhaps more generally, and as the mobile unit that can be mounted or hang with any direction in space.
Described temperature adjustment device 1 can be provided with electric energy by different modes.A kind of possible mode provides an energy provides the unit to produce equipment 2 and pressure wave generator 9 to described air-flow, if perhaps requirement also provides the electric energy with desired voltage to described firing equipment 20.Because the Stirling cooling device is lower to power requirement, therefore another kind of possible mode is that a built-in battery is used to provide electric energy.For example, when requiring temperature when 25 ℃ are reduced to 20 ℃, described support 25 has the internal diameter of 10cm, and air moves with the speed of 0.5m/s, and described Stirling cooling device only has 20 to 25W power consumption.
